The life and death of classical music; featuring the 100 best and 20 worst recordings ever made.

Lebrecht, Norman.
Anchor Books, ©2007    324 p.    $14.95    ML3790
978-1-4000-9658-9

Lebrecht reviews milestones in the history of classical music recording and lists his opinion of the 100 best and 20 worst recordings. From the beginning of the twentieth century, he discusses the roles of conductors, record labels, pertinent changes in the recording industry, and the reasons for its demise. The second section of the book lists the recordings, ranging from 1902 to 2004, with discussion of their relative merit — or poor quality. Lebrecht is assistant editor of the Evening Standard in London, a writer, and presenter of BBC's lebrecht.live. (Annotation ©2008 Book News Inc. Portland, OR)
